Why Get a Russian Blue?
- Hypoallergenic: Now, I ain’t no scientist, but they say these cats are good for folks with allergies. That means less sneezin’ and wheezin’ in your home.
- Health Guarantee: If you find a good breeder, they’ll check them little ones for health issues. You want your new friend to be strong and healthy, right?
- Great Companions: Russian Blues are friendly, but they can be a bit shy ’round strangers. Don’t worry though, they warm up once they know you.
Now, if you thinkin’ about how much to spend, well, it can vary. If you adopt, it might cost ya ’round $100 to $300. That helps cover the vet visits and such. But if you buy from a fancy breeder, expect to shell out $400 to $1,000. That price can go up depending on how good the parents are and how well-known the breeder is.
Living with a Russian Blue

These cats, they like their space sometimes. If you got a busy house, make sure they got a little nook to hide away when they need a break. They do fine alone, even if you’re out all day. Just don’t forget to play with ’em when you get back. They love a good chase after a feather or a ball.
And lemme tell ya, they ain’t mean. Russian Blues get along well with kids, just like a gentle friend. They’re not the kind to scratch or bite unless somethin’ really bothers ’em. If you got young’uns, they make a good match.
Now, when you bring one of these cats home, give ’em time to adjust. They might hide a bit at first, but with love and patience, they’ll be snuggled up in your lap before ya know it. Make sure you have some nice toys for them to play with, too. Keeps ’em happy and healthy.
